## Authentication

Heads up: the nightly reindex job (`reindex_nightly.py`) talks to the Lanternfish search cluster, and that cluster won't accept anonymous writes anymore — we locked it down last sprint. The job now authenticates as the `reindex-runner` service identity against Corvid Gateway, and the token is injected via the `LF_INDEX_TOKEN` env var in the scheduler config. Nothing clever going on, just a bearer header on every batch request. For review purposes, the staging credential currently in use is listed below.

service key, kadug-kadup: kto15_rN23XLAYImmZgrJ

### Step 4: Deploy SpoolHawk Service

SpoolHawk handles print-job queuing for the Marbeck office platform. The container runs as a non-root user, listens only on the internal mesh, and rejects unsigned job payloads. Before promotion, confirm the admission policy checks manifest signatures and that audit logging is enabled. Deploy artifacts must be signed prior to registry push; the current release signing key follows.

deploy key for kajof-fajop: bky6_gDHw9Q

Handover for the weekly sync: I'm passing the Lumenfeed events table work to Darya. We finished partitioning by month back through January; older rows live in the archive schema. The partition-creation job runs nightly and pre-creates two months ahead, so no manual action is needed unless it fails twice in a row. Queries that don't filter on event_date will still scan everything — that's the next cleanup item. The partitioning job reads everything it needs from the following values.

settings of tagef-bawif:
DRUIX_HOST=druix.zemvarlabs.internal
DRUIX_PORT=8000

**Mgmt Meeting Minutes — Retiring the Brightline Range**

Quick recap for sales leads at Fenholt Supplies: we agreed to retire the Brightline fixture range by year-end. Remaining stock moves to clearance pricing next month, and accounts on standing orders get migrated to the Lumetta range. Trade-in incentives were approved in principle. The confidential note on next steps sits just below.

board note of bajof-bajeg: The pricing group signed off on a budget of $13.4 million for Project Sildor. The renewal with Lamixek Holdings closes at $48.9 million a year, 49 percent above the last contract.